Aug 10, 2026Inspection Completed - No Further ActionRoutine Inspection

Met inspection standards. 2 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.

1 High priority1 Intermediate0 Basic
What the inspector wrote — 2 findings
Employee failed to wash hands before putting on gloves to initiate a task working with food. Observed employee working with bacon picking up item from floor and not changing gloves washing hands. Educated employee. Employee changed gloves, washed hands, and put in new gloves.
High priority/12A-07-5/Corrected On-Site
Handwash sink not accessible for employee use at all times. Observed handwash sink in dishwash area blocked by mop bucket. Operator removed mop bucket.
Intermediate/31A-09-4/Corrected On-Site

This record follows the licence, not the owner. Restaurants change hands and the licence history normally does not, so an older entry may describe people who no longer run the place. Every inspection above links to the state's own report. Something wrong? Tell us.
